Cone Penetration Test Correlations for Missouri Soils
The objective of this research is to provide MoDOT with Missouri-specific guidance on the use of cone penetration test (CPT) measurements to estimate geotechnical parameters. This work will focus on two areas: (1) Development of Missouri-specific correlations to estimate undrained strengths of Missouri clays from CPT measurements. and (2) Investigation of inconsistencies between standard penetration test (SPT) and CPT derived values for granular soils in Missouri.
